Output d25698e0af5509a11905b4feea2137826848c1a60d9c17f29a408e940f007b8e:83

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95a24029c18c3421ef49951678de52d79d4d97ddd36a5b3281f76df9827d3cb0
address
bc1pjk3yq2wp3s6zrm6fj5t83hjj67w5m97a6d49kv5p7aklnqna8jcq3zq68m
transaction
d25698e0af5509a11905b4feea2137826848c1a60d9c17f29a408e940f007b8e
spent
true